Item 1.01. Entry into a Material Definitive Agreement.
On August 31, 2017, Ellie Mae, Inc. (the “Company”) and Victory Merger Sub, Inc., a wholly-owned subsidiary of the Company (“Merger Sub”), entered into an Agreement and Plan of Merger (the “Merger Agreement”) with Velocify, Inc. (“Velocify”) and Fortis Advisors LLC, as the Representative. Pursuant to the Merger Agreement, Merger Sub will merge with and into Velocify, with Velocify continuing as the surviving corporation (the “Surviving Corporation”) and a wholly-owned subsidiary of the Company (the “Merger”).
The aggregate consideration payable in exchange for all of the outstanding equity interests of Velocify is approximately $128 million in cash. The consideration is subject to an adjustment based on (i) working capital adjustment provisions, (ii) the amounts of cash, indebtedness, transaction expenses and unpaid taxes of Velocify and (iii) indemnification obligations of certain Velocify securityholders after the closing of the Merger. A portion of the consideration will be placed into an escrow account to satisfy any potential claims under the indemnification obligations of certain Velocify securityholders described in the Merger Agreement.

The Merger Agreement contains customary representations, warranties and covenants by the Company, Merger Sub, and Velocify. The closing of the Merger is subject to customary closing conditions, including the expiration or termination of any waiting periods applicable to the consummation of the Merger under applicable antitrust and competition laws. The description of the Merger Agreement contained in this Item 1.01 is qualified in its entirety by the Merger Agreement filed as Exhibit 2.1 and is incorporated herein by reference.
